The Expo Passions Bigoudènes will unfold at Chapelle Saint-Pierre in Penmarch from July 1 to July 30, 2026. This event celebrates the rich artistic and cultural heritage of the Bigouden region. Attendees can look forward to engaging exhibitions featuring works from local artisans and artists, alongside a range of activities for children. Throughout the month, live performances by musicians, instrumentalists, and singers will showcase Breton, rock, and world music in an open-air environment. This mix of artistic expression promises delight for both locals and visitors. Additionally, art history lectures presented by Jean Deulceux will offer deeper insights into the crafts and artworks defining this cultural landscape.
